Are there minimum duration courses like six months or one year available abroad for a Diploma?
Yes, short-term diploma and professional certificate programs ranging from six months to one year are widely available abroad. These options are ideal for career upskilling, fast-tracking into higher education, or obtaining vocational training without committing to a multi-year degree. Global Diploma Options and Durations
| Country | Typical Duration | Focus Areas |
|---|---|---|
| United Kingdom | 6 to 12 months | Business Management, Computing, Art & Design |
| Europe (Italy, France, Spain) | 6 months to 1 year | Culinary Arts, Fashion, Interior/Graphic Design |
| United States & Canada | 6 months to 1 year | Community College Certificates, Post-Graduate Business/Tech |
Important Factors to Keep in Mind
- Verify if the destination country's student or short-term visa policies accommodate courses lasting under one year.
- Keep in mind that short 6-month or 1-year diplomas usually do not qualify you for long-term post-study work permits.
- Look for pathway or articulation diplomas if your long-term goal involves transferring credits into a full degree.
My Advice
Before finalizing your application, check whether your chosen institution is properly accredited or registered to issue valid study visas. Always align your short-term course choice with your specific career or academic progression goals.
